欢迎访问网络入门网
掌握电脑、编程和网络的入门技术零基础学习者提供清晰的成长路径
合作联系QQ2917376929
您的位置: 首页>>网络技术>>正文
网络技术

学好Vue要多久?一位资深开发者的经验分享

时间:2025-07-11 作者:网络入门 点击:1133次

学好Vue.js所需时间因个人学习能力、投入时间以及实践机会的不同而有所差异,对于一位资深开发者来说,他们通常具备较强的学习能力和实践经验,因此可能相对较短时间便能掌握Vue.js的核心概念和技能。这并不意味着只需要短时间内就能学会Vue.js,要想真正精通并熟练运用Vue.js,需要不断地学习和实践,这位资深开发者建议,至少需要投入数月的时间,每天抽出一定的时间进行学习和实践,才能初步掌握Vue.js,他们还强调,只有通过实际的项目应用,才能真正理解和掌握Vue.js的精髓。如果你想学习Vue.js,不要期望能够在短时间内快速上手,而是应该保持耐心,坚持不懈地学习和实践,通过不断地积累经验和提升技能,最终成为一名优秀的Vue.js开发者。

本文目录导读:

  1. Vue基础阶段
  2. Vue进阶阶段
  3. 实际项目实战
  4. 学习资源推荐
  5. 学习Vue的时间规划
  6. 第一阶段:入门Vue(1-2周)
  7. 第二阶段:进阶Vue(2-3周)
  8. 第三阶段:实战Vue(1-2个月)
  9. 总结:学好Vue需要多久?

大家好,我是小王,一名专注于前端开发的工程师,今天我想和大家聊聊一个热门话题:学好Vue要多久?作为一个有着多年经验的开发者,我深知学习Vue的艰辛与乐趣,我将结合自己的学习经历和体会,为大家详细解答这个问题。

Vue基础阶段

我们需要了解Vue的基础知识,Vue是一个渐进式JavaScript框架,易学易用,上手快,在学习Vue之前,建议先掌握一些基本的HTML、CSS和JavaScript知识,因为Vue是基于这些基础知识构建的。

问题1:Vue基础部分需要掌握哪些知识点?

学好Vue要多久?一位资深开发者的经验分享

  • Vue的基本概念和特点
  • Vue实例的创建和挂载
  • 基本的模板语法和指令
  • 条件渲染和列表渲染
  • 列表渲染和条件渲染的案例

回答1: 学习Vue基础阶段,你需要掌握Vue的基本概念、实例创建、模板语法、条件渲染、列表渲染等知识点,这些知识是理解Vue框架的基础,也是后续深入学习的前提。

Vue进阶阶段

掌握了Vue基础之后,我们可以开始学习Vue的高级特性,如组件化、路由管理、状态管理等,这些高级特性将帮助你更好地应对复杂的项目需求。

问题2:Vue进阶阶段需要掌握哪些知识点?

  • Vue组件的定义和注册
  • Vue路由的概念和使用
  • Vuex状态管理的原理和应用
  • Vue.js的响应式原理和性能优化

回答2: 在Vue进阶阶段,你需要学习组件的定义和注册、Vue路由的管理、Vuex状态管理的应用以及Vue的响应式原理和性能优化等方面的知识,这些知识将帮助你更好地应对复杂的项目需求,提升你的开发效率。

实际项目实战

理论学习固然重要,但真正的项目实践才是检验学习成果的最佳方式,通过参与实际项目,你可以将所学知识应用到实际开发中,不断提升自己的技能水平。

问题3:如何有效地进行Vue项目的实战练习?

  • 参与开源项目或自己发起个人项目
  • 结合实际业务场景编写Vue代码
  • 学会使用Vue CLI快速搭建项目框架
  • 参加线上技术交流活动,分享学习心得

回答3: 有效地进行Vue项目的实战练习,需要你积极参与开源项目或自己发起个人项目,结合实际业务场景编写Vue代码,并学会使用Vue CLI快速搭建项目框架,参加线上技术交流活动,分享学习心得,也是提升实战能力的好方法。

学习资源推荐

在学习Vue的过程中,选择合适的学习资源非常重要,以下是一些优质的学习资源推荐:

学好Vue要多久?一位资深开发者的经验分享

  • 官方文档:Vue官方网站提供了详细的文档和教程,是学习Vue不可或缺的资源。
  • 在线课程:各大在线教育平台如慕课网、极客时间等提供了多门Vue相关的在线课程,适合系统学习。
  • 技术博客和论坛:一些技术博客和论坛如掘金、CSDN等网站上有很多关于Vue的教程和讨论,可以参考他人的经验。
  • 开源项目:参与开源项目是学习Vue的一种很好的方式,可以通过阅读他人的代码来学习和提高自己。

学习Vue的时间规划

我们来谈谈如何规划学习Vue的时间,学习Vue的时间因人而异,取决于你的基础和学习能力,以下是一个大致的学习时间规划供你参考:

  • 第一周:集中精力学习Vue基础知识和核心概念。
  • 第二周至第四周:深入学习Vue的高级特性,如组件化、路由管理和状态管理。
  • 第五周至第八周:通过实际项目实战巩固所学知识,解决遇到的问题。
  • 第九周以后:持续学习和实践,不断提升自己的技能水平。

学好Vue并不是一件容易的事情,需要付出大量的时间和努力,但是只要你保持学习的热情和耐心,不断积累经验和提升技能,相信你一定能够掌握Vue并应用于实际项目中,在这个过程中,不要忘记及时总结和反思自己的学习方法和成果,以便更好地调整学习计划和方法。

也要善于利用各种学习资源和机会,如参加技术交流活动、阅读相关书籍和博客、参与开源项目等,这些都将有助于你更好地学习和掌握Vue。

学好Vue需要时间和毅力,但只要坚持不懈地努力,相信你一定能够成为一名优秀的Vue开发者!加油!

知识扩展阅读

嘿,最近是不是在考虑学Vue啊?是不是被各种“Vue太火了,学它不吃香”给绕晕了?别急,今天咱们就来聊聊,到底学好Vue需要多久,毕竟,谁不想在简历上写上一句“精通Vue.js,全栈开发工程师”呢?

先说一句实在话:Vue不是一天就能学会的,但也不是遥不可及,关键看你每天愿意花多少时间,有没有明确的目标,以及是否愿意动手实践,今天我就从入门到进阶,给你列个清晰的时间表,顺便聊聊学习中的坑和避坑方法。


第一阶段:入门Vue(1-2周)

学什么?

  • Vue的基本语法(模板、指令、数据绑定)
  • 组件化思想
  • Vue CLI的使用
  • Vue的生命周期

需要时间?

每天坚持2-3小时,大概需要1-2周。

学好Vue要多久?一位资深开发者的经验分享

学完能做什么?

你能写一个简单的待办事项清单(Todo List),页面能动态更新,还能用Vue Router实现页面跳转,虽然看起来简单,但这就是Vue的“Hello World”,也是你迈出的第一步。

学习路径对比表:

阶段 时间建议 目标
入门 Vue基础语法、组件、路由 1-2周 能写简单页面,理解数据绑定
进阶 Vue3新特性、Composition API、状态管理 2-3周 掌握复杂项目开发
实战 完整项目开发、性能优化、工程化 1-2个月 能独立开发中大型项目

第二阶段:进阶Vue(2-3周)

学什么?

  • Vue3的Composition API(这是未来!)
  • Pinia状态管理库
  • Vue CLI的工程化配置
  • Vue组件库(Element Plus、Ant Design Vue)
  • Vue Router的高级用法
  • Vue的响应式原理(Proxy vs Object.defineProperty)

需要时间?

每天3-4小时,持续2-3周。

学完能做什么?

你现在可以开发一个中等复杂度的后台管理系统,比如一个电商网站的商品列表页,用户登录页,订单管理页,页面之间可以跳转,数据可以动态加载,还能用Pinia管理用户登录状态。

常见问题解答:

问:没有编程基础能学会Vue吗? 答:当然可以!Vue的语法比React简单,比Angular亲民,只要你会HTML和CSS,JavaScript基础稍微有点就行,别担心,网上有超多免费教程,从零开始也能学会。

问:学完Vue能做什么项目? 答:从简单的个人博客,到中大型的后台管理系统,甚至移动端的跨平台开发(用Vite+Vue+Taro),都能搞定。

问:学Vue需要多久? 答:这取决于你每天的学习时间,如果你每天能投入3-4小时,大概2-3个月就能达到中高级水平,如果你只是想应付面试,1个月也能应付。

学好Vue要多久?一位资深开发者的经验分享


第三阶段:实战Vue(1-2个月)

学什么?

  • 完整项目的开发流程(需求分析、设计、编码、测试)
  • Vue的性能优化(懒加载、代码分割、虚拟DOM)
  • Vue的工程化(Webpack/Vite配置、单元测试、CI/CD)
  • Vue的生态(Vant、Element Plus等UI库的使用)
  • Vue的测试(Jest、Cypress)

需要时间?

每天4-6小时,持续1-2个月。

学完能做什么?

你现在可以独立开发一个完整的项目,比如一个电商网站、一个社交平台、一个后台管理系统,项目中会用到Vuex/Pinia、Vue Router、Axios、Webpack/Vite等工具,还能写出可维护、可扩展的代码。

实战案例:

小明是一个前端工程师,他花了2个月时间,用Vue开发了一个电商后台系统,系统包括商品管理、订单管理、用户管理、权限管理等功能,他用了Vue Router做路由,Pinia做状态管理,Element Plus做UI,Axios做API请求,Webpack做打包,项目上线后,得到了领导的高度评价,还被公司用作新员工培训项目。


学好Vue需要多久?

阶段 时间 能力
入门 1-2周 能写简单页面,理解Vue基础
进阶 2-3周 能开发中等复杂度项目
实战 1-2个月 能独立开发完整项目

如果你每天能坚持学习3-4小时,大概2-3个月后,你就能自信地说:“我学好Vue了!”这只是个大概的时间表,具体还要看你自己的学习节奏和基础。

送你一句学习Vue的至理名言:“光看不练假把式,光练不看真把式。” 别光看视频、看书,赶紧动手写代码吧!写代码才是学好Vue的唯一捷径!

如果你有什么学习上的问题,或者想了解更多的Vue实战技巧,欢迎在评论区留言,我们一起讨论!

相关的知识点:

揭秘黑客行业,在线接单免费背后的真相

如何能够关联男朋友微信聊天,【看这4种方法】

百科科普黑客私人接单,揭秘背后的真相与风险

百科科普黑客接单网,揭开网络接单项目的神秘面纱

百科科普警惕私人接单免费黑客——揭露网络非法行为的真相

百科科普揭秘黑客在线查记录接单,真相与风险洞察